摘要: 选取宁夏24个气象站1955—2003年沙尘暴观测资料及其沙尘暴出现当日的能见度定时观测资料,分析研究了宁夏单站沙尘暴天气强度划分时存在的问题,结果表明:用沙尘暴当日定时观测最小能见度资料划分沙尘暴天气强度存在很大的片面性,有53%的沙尘暴天气无法划分其强弱、69%的沙尘暴天气发生在非定时观测时间段内,通过典型个例,对比分析了日定时观测最小能见度对沙尘暴天气强度划分的影响和存在的偏差,为历史沙尘暴强度的划分提供参考。

Abstract: The duststorm observational data and the timed observational visibility data in the same day of Ningxia 24 stations from 1955 to 2003 were selected to analyze the problems existed in intensity division of duststorms in single station. The result shows that to divide the intensity of duststorm by the minimum timed observational visibility data in the same day has big unilateralism, the intensity of 53% duststorms can't be divided and, 69% duststorms happened in unobserved time. Based on typical cases, the problems of applying daily minimum visibility in intensity division of duststorms and its deviation were analyzed, which has provided reference for the intensity division of historical duststorms.
